Q: How does StormRelay fan out weather alerts? A: Ingested alerts are deduplicated by region hash, then published to per-county topics. Each subscriber shard pulls independently, so a slow consumer cannot stall the whole fan-out. If alerts appear delayed, check shard lag first, not the ingest side — ingest is almost never the bottleneck. Note that severity upgrades create a new alert rather than mutating the old one, which affects dedupe behavior. The topology diagram and lag dashboards are on the page below.

wiki page, fahaf-yagag: https://confluence.qorvellabs.internal/pages/display/pages/display

# Settings: ProctorQueue service
# Reviewed for the Calverton security audit.
# This block configures the exam-proctoring queue. Workers claim proctoring
# sessions from the queue table, heartbeat every 15s, and release claims on
# timeout. TLS is required for all DB traffic; credentials rotate via the
# Keffler vault every 30 days. Queue rows contain session IDs only — no
# candidate media. The worker pool connects to the queue database using the
# connection string that follows.

replica DSN, yahaf-yagaf: mongodb://tamath_svc:a2netSk3RZMuTj@db-d084.novacsoft.internal:5432/ralmir

Handover — pool car key cabinet

Facilities desk: cabinet moved from loading bay to Room G12, Haverstone Building. All twelve fobs accounted for at handover; fob 7 has a cracked casing, replacement ordered. Log sheet stays on the clipboard inside the cabinet — check it daily. Fuel cards are in the top tray; don't issue them without a booking reference. Cabinet servicing contract renews in March. Access to G12 requires the standard facilities pass code, which is below.

door code, yagap-bahof: bdg-O-05